ปัญหานี้มักปรากฏบน Internet Explorer เมื่อผู้ใช้พยายามเรียกใช้สคริปต์ต่างๆ บนเว็บไซต์หรือเมื่อใช้คำสั่ง ActiveX ผู้ใช้บางคนยังรายงานว่าพวกเขาเริ่มสังเกตเห็นข้อผิดพลาดหลังจากติดตั้งส่วนเสริมและส่วนขยายต่างๆ ใน Internet Explorer ซึ่งทำงานไม่สำเร็จเช่นกัน
Microsoft ไม่ได้บันทึกปัญหาไว้อย่างดี แต่มีผู้ใช้รายอื่นจำนวนมากรายงานว่าพบปัญหาและสามารถแก้ไขได้ด้วยตนเอง พวกเขาได้แบ่งปันวิธีการของพวกเขาและเราตัดสินใจที่จะรวบรวมไว้ในบทความนี้ อย่าลืมปฏิบัติตามคำแนะนำอย่างระมัดระวังเพื่อแก้ไขปัญหา!
อะไรทำให้เกิดข้อผิดพลาด “เซิร์ฟเวอร์อัตโนมัติไม่สามารถสร้างวัตถุ” บน Windows
รายการสาเหตุที่เป็นไปได้จริง ๆ แล้วประกอบด้วยสาเหตุหลักเดียวที่ทำให้คนทั่วโลกปวดหัว
- การตั้งค่าความปลอดภัย – เกี่ยวข้องกับตัวเลือกความปลอดภัยภายในตัวเลือกอินเทอร์เน็ต ซึ่งไม่อนุญาตให้เบราว์เซอร์เรียกใช้สคริปต์ เว้นแต่ว่าเบราว์เซอร์จะทำเครื่องหมายว่าปลอดภัย นี่เป็นปัญหาโดยเฉพาะอย่างยิ่งสำหรับการควบคุม ActiveX ที่ผู้ใช้สร้างขึ้น และจำเป็นต้องเปลี่ยนตัวเลือกเพื่อกำจัดข้อผิดพลาด
- ตัวเลือกอินเทอร์เน็ตอื่นๆ – หากมีการตั้งค่าอื่นๆ ที่กำหนดค่าไม่ถูกต้องใน Internet Explorer การรีเซ็ตทั้งหมดควรแก้ปัญหาได้
โซลูชันที่ 1:เปลี่ยนการตั้งค่าความปลอดภัยและล้างข้อมูลการท่องเว็บ
หากปัญหาปรากฏขึ้นเมื่อพยายามเรียกใช้ตัวควบคุม ActiveX หรือหลังจากติดตั้งโปรแกรมเสริม/ส่วนขยายของ Internet Explorer สาเหตุอาจเป็นเพราะการตั้งค่าความปลอดภัยทางอินเทอร์เน็ตของเบราว์เซอร์ของคุณเข้มงวดเกินไปสำหรับคำสั่งที่จะเรียกใช้ คุณแก้ไขปัญหาได้โดยลดการตั้งค่าความปลอดภัย
- เปิด Internet Explorer โดยค้นหาใน เมนูเริ่ม หรือโดยการระบุตำแหน่งบนพีซีของคุณและคลิก ไอคอนฟันเฟือง อยู่ที่มุมขวาบนเพื่อเข้าถึงเมนูแบบเลื่อนลง
- จากเมนูที่เปิดขึ้น ให้คลิกที่ ตัวเลือกอินเทอร์เน็ต และรอให้หน้าต่างเปิดขึ้น
- นำทางไปยัง ความปลอดภัย แท็บแล้วคลิก ไซต์ที่เชื่อถือได้ . ใน ระดับความปลอดภัยของโซนนี้ ให้คลิกส่วน ระดับที่กำหนดเอง… เลื่อนไปจนเจอ ตัวควบคุมและปลั๊กอิน ActiveX .
- ตรวจสอบให้แน่ใจว่าช่องทำเครื่องหมายถัดจาก เริ่มต้นและสคริปต์ตัวควบคุม ActiveX ไม่ได้ทำเครื่องหมายว่าปลอดภัยสำหรับการเขียนสคริปต์ ถูกตั้งค่าเป็น เปิดใช้งาน . คลิก ตกลง ปุ่มที่ด้านล่างของทั้งสองหน้าต่าง
- กลับไปที่ตัวเลือกอินเทอร์เน็ต หน้าจอ แต่คราวนี้ ไปที่ ทั่วไป แท็บ ภายใต้ ประวัติการเรียกดู ให้คลิกปุ่ม ลบ… ปุ่ม.
- ตรวจสอบว่าคุณทำเครื่องหมายที่ช่องถัดจากไฟล์อินเทอร์เน็ตชั่วคราวและไฟล์เว็บไซต์ , คุกกี้และข้อมูลเว็บไซต์ และ การป้องกันการติดตาม การกรอง ActiveX และห้ามติดตาม . รายการอื่นๆ เป็นตัวเลือก คลิกปุ่ม ลบ และรีสตาร์ทคอมพิวเตอร์เพื่อดูว่าปัญหายังคงปรากฏบนคอมพิวเตอร์ของคุณหรือไม่
หมายเหตุ :ผู้ใช้บางคนรายงานว่าด้วยเหตุผลบางอย่าง เริ่มต้นและตัวควบคุม ActiveX ของสคริปต์ไม่ได้ทำเครื่องหมายว่าปลอดภัยสำหรับการเขียนสคริปต์ ตัวเลือกจะเป็นสีเทาสำหรับพวกเขา การหลีกเลี่ยงปัญหานี้ทำได้ง่ายและต้องแก้ไขรีจิสทรี
- เนื่องจากคุณกำลังจะแก้ไขรีจิสตรีคีย์ เราขอแนะนำให้คุณอ่านบทความนี้ที่เราได้เผยแพร่เพื่อให้คุณสำรองข้อมูลรีจิสตรี้ได้อย่างปลอดภัย เพื่อป้องกันปัญหาอื่นๆ อย่างไรก็ตาม จะไม่มีอะไรผิดพลาดเกิดขึ้นหากคุณทำตามขั้นตอนอย่างระมัดระวังและถูกต้อง
- เปิดตัวแก้ไขรีจิสทรี โดยพิมพ์ “regedit” ในแถบค้นหา เมนู Start หรือกล่องโต้ตอบ Run ซึ่งสามารถเข้าถึงได้ด้วย Windows Key + R คีย์ผสม ไปที่คีย์ต่อไปนี้ในรีจิสทรีของคุณโดยไปที่บานหน้าต่างด้านซ้าย:
H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\CurrentVersion\Internet Settings\Zones\3
- คลิกที่ปุ่มนี้และพยายามค้นหารายการชื่อ 1201 . หากไม่มี ให้สร้าง ค่า DWORD . ใหม่ รายการที่เรียกว่า 1201 โดยคลิกขวาที่ด้านขวาของหน้าต่างและเลือก ใหม่>> ค่า DWORD (32 บิต) . คลิกขวาและเลือก แก้ไข ตัวเลือกจากเมนูบริบท
- ใน แก้ไข หน้าต่าง ใต้ ข้อมูลค่า ส่วนเปลี่ยนค่าเป็น 3 และใช้การเปลี่ยนแปลงที่คุณทำ ตรวจสอบให้แน่ใจว่าฐานถูกตั้งค่าเป็นทศนิยม ยืนยัน กล่องโต้ตอบความปลอดภัยที่อาจปรากฏขึ้นในระหว่างกระบวนการนี้
- ขณะนี้ คุณสามารถรีสตาร์ทคอมพิวเตอร์ด้วยตนเองได้โดยคลิก เมนูเริ่ม>> ปุ่มเปิด/ปิด>> รีสตาร์ท และตรวจสอบเพื่อดูว่าปัญหาหายไปหรือไม่ วิธีนี้น่าจะแก้ปัญหาได้ในทันที
ถ้าคุณต้องการหลีกเลี่ยงการใช้รีจิสทรี คุณสามารถทำได้เช่นเดียวกันภายใน Local Group Policy Editor โปรดทราบว่าชุดขั้นตอนนี้แนะนำสำหรับผู้ใช้ที่มีเวอร์ชัน Windows Enterprise หรือ Pro เท่านั้น เนื่องจากไม่มีตัวแก้ไขนโยบายกลุ่มใน Windows Home
- ใช้ คีย์ Windows + R คีย์ผสม (แตะคีย์พร้อมกัน) เพื่อเปิด เรียกใช้ กล่องโต้ตอบ ป้อน “gpedit. msc ” ในกล่องโต้ตอบ Run และกดปุ่ม OK เพื่อเปิด Local Group Policy Editor เครื่องมือ. ใน Windows 10 คุณสามารถลองพิมพ์ Group Policy Editor ใน เมนู Start และคลิกผลลัพธ์ด้านบนสุด
- บนบานหน้าต่างนำทางด้านซ้ายของ Local Group Policy Editor ภายใต้ การกำหนดค่าคอมพิวเตอร์ ดับเบิลคลิกที่ เทมเพลตการดูแลระบบ และไปที่ คอมโพเนนต์ของ Windows> Internet Explorer > แผงควบคุมอินเทอร์เน็ต> หน้าความปลอดภัย> โซนอินเทอร์เน็ต
- เลือก โซนอินเทอร์เน็ต โฟลเดอร์โดยคลิกซ้ายที่โฟลเดอร์และดูส่วนด้านขวาของโฟลเดอร์
- ดับเบิลคลิกที่ "เริ่มต้นและสคริปต์ตัวควบคุม ActiveX ไม่ถูกทำเครื่องหมายว่าปลอดภัยสำหรับการเขียนสคริปต์ ” และตรวจสอบปุ่มตัวเลือกถัดจาก “เปิดใช้งาน ” ตัวเลือก
- ใช้การเปลี่ยนแปลงที่คุณได้ทำไว้ก่อนที่จะออก การเปลี่ยนแปลงจะไม่มีผลจนกว่าคุณจะรีสตาร์ท
- สุดท้าย ให้รีบูตคอมพิวเตอร์เพื่อบันทึกการเปลี่ยนแปลงและตรวจดูว่าคุณยังตกเป็นเป้าหมายของข้อผิดพลาดหรือไม่
โซลูชันที่ 2:รีเซ็ตการตั้งค่า Internet Explorer
นี่เป็นโซลูชันพื้นฐานที่สามารถช่วยให้คุณแก้ไขปัญหาได้รวดเร็วที่สุด วิธีนี้ช่วยผู้ใช้ได้จริง โดยเฉพาะผู้ที่ต้องการทดลองติดตั้ง Internet Explorer เป็นจำนวนมาก อย่าลืมลองสิ่งนี้!
- เปิด Internet Explorer โดยการค้นหาหรือดับเบิลคลิกที่ทางลัดบน เดสก์ท็อป ให้เลือก เครื่องมือ ที่ส่วนบนขวาของหน้า จากนั้นเลือก ตัวเลือกอินเทอร์เน็ต .
- คุณยังสามารถเปิด แผงควบคุม โดยการค้นหา เปลี่ยน ดูโดย ตัวเลือก หมวดหมู่ และคลิกที่ เครือข่ายและอินเทอร์เน็ต . คลิกที่ ตัวเลือกอินเทอร์เน็ต ซึ่งควรเป็นรายการที่สองในหน้าต่างใหม่และดำเนินการแก้ไข
- นำทางไปยัง ขั้นสูง แท็บ จากนั้นคลิกที่ รีเซ็ต เลือก ลบการตั้งค่าส่วนบุคคล กล่องกาเครื่องหมายหากคุณต้องการลบประวัติการเรียกดู ผู้ให้บริการค้นหา ตัวช่วยดำเนินการ หน้าแรก และข้อมูลการกรองแบบ InPrivate ขอแนะนำถ้าคุณต้องการรีเซ็ตเบราว์เซอร์ของคุณจริงๆ แต่การเลือกตัวเลือกนี้เป็นทางเลือกหากคุณทำตามขั้นตอนทั้งหมดจากโซลูชัน 1 แล้ว
- ใน รีเซ็ตการตั้งค่า Internet Explorer กล่องโต้ตอบ คลิก รีเซ็ต และรอให้ Internet Explorer ใช้การตั้งค่าเริ่มต้นให้เสร็จสิ้น คลิกที่ ปิด>> ตกลง .
- เมื่อ Internet Explorer ใช้การตั้งค่าเริ่มต้นเสร็จแล้ว ให้คลิก ปิด แล้วคลิก ตกลง . ตรวจสอบว่าคุณสามารถใช้งานได้โดยไม่มีปัญหา